Description

Job Duties :

Daily access to email

Keep track of all assigned case dates

Participate in all trainings assigned (cases, compliance, other)

Study all facts of the assigned case script, train and perform with accuracy, and be able to respond positively to constructive feedback

Call (as soon as possible) if unable to attend a scheduled session

Arrive at scheduled time

Dress appropriately for each case (casual, business, exam gown, etc.)

Consistently perform the case to ensure each learner is seeing the same portrayal of the scenario

Make adjustments to the way the case is played if requested by faculty or SP staff.

Remember what each student / resident asked and did during the encounter and record it on the standardized patient checklist accurately.

  • Keep all cases and encounters with students / residents confidential.
  • Other duties.
